Former Japanese Prime Minister Shinzo Abe Assassinated
Former Japanese Prime Minister Shinzo Abe was assassinated during a shooting while giving a speech on a street early this morning. According to Japanese media outlets, Abe was taken from the scene of the shooting unconscious and in cardiac arrest with no vital signs. Japan’s current Prime Minister Fumio Kishida returned to Tokyo from a campaign trip after the shooting and spoke to reporters at his office. Kishida called the attack ‘dastardly and barbaric’ and said that the crime during the election campaign was absolutely unforgivable. Tributes from around the world started pouring in after Abe’s death was confirmed. President Biden said he was “stunned, outraged, and deeply saddened by the news” and also added that “The United States stands with Japan in this moment of grief.”
